Chennai Corporation Collects ₹9.36 Crore in Fines in 74 Days for Civic Violations

Posted on: 15/Dec/2025 11:14:06 AM

The Greater Chennai Corporation (GCC) has collected ₹9.36 crore in fines over the last 74 days from residents and commercial establishments for violations across five major categories, including plastic usage, conservancy, mosquito breeding, illegal sewage connections, and park-related offences.

Between October 1 and December 14, over 80,000 penalty transactions were recorded using more than 1,000 Point of Sale (POS) machines deployed across all city zones. On Saturday, December 14 alone, enforcement teams collected ₹1.14 crore, registering 15,372 transactions, reflecting intensified civic enforcement.

Category-wise fine collection during the 74-day period includes:

- -₹5.85 crore for conservancy violations

- ₹2.34 crore for plastic-related offences

- ₹1.01 crore for mosquito breeding

- ₹2.65 crore for park-related violations, including unauthorised tree pruning and felling

- ₹12.35 lakh for illegal stormwater drain (SWD) connections

Additionally, fines amounting to ₹14.52 lakh were imposed for the burning of solid waste across commercial, public, and private premises. Mosquito breeding violations across shops, apartments, and construction sites alone accounted for over ₹55 lakh in fines.

Under the ongoing ban on single-use plastics, penalties were levied as follows:

- ₹100 for small establishments

- ₹1,000 for large establishments

- ₹25,000 for plastic manufacturers

From October 1 onwards, the GCC collected ₹72.20 lakh from small commercial establishments and ₹68.52 lakh from medium commercial establishments for various violations. Officials stated that strict enforcement will continue to ensure public health, environmental safety, and civic discipline across Chennai.
